MAUBOUSSIN. A LADY'S 18K WHITE GOLD, DIAMOND AND LAPIS LAZULI-SET RECTANGULAR WRISTWATCH WITH BRACELET Signed Mauboussin, No. 102W, circa 1998 With quartz movement, pavé-set diamond dial, Roman numerals on lapis lazuli-set ends, in rectangular case with diamond-set sides and arched ends, back secured by four screws, together with an 18k white gold and blue crocodile skin bracelet with diamond-set rim and concealed double deployant clasp, case, dial and movement signed 23 mm. long; overall length approximately 170 mm.
